directions

  •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• Sift together flour, baking powder, salt, and baking soda.
  • Add nuts, mix well.
  • Melt butter and mix with sugar, stir in eggs and vanilla
  • Add flour mixture to sugar mixture slowly
  • Pour into a greased 9 x 13 pan and sprinkle chips on top
  • Bake for 30 minutes or until toothpick comes out clean.
